Chaos is a genus of single-celled amoeboid organisms in the family Amoebidae.The largest and most-known species, the so-called "giant amoeba" (Chaos carolinensis), can reach lengths up to 5 mm, although most specimens fall between 1 and 3 mm. [3] [4] [5]

Pelomyxa is a genus of giant flagellar amoebae, usually 500–800 μm but occasionally up to 5 mm in length, found in anaerobic or microaerobic bottom sediments of stagnant freshwater ponds or slow-moving streams. [1] The genus was created by R. Greeff, in 1874, with Pelomyxa palustris as its type species. [2]
An amoeba of the genus Mayorella (Amoebozoa, Discosea). Amoebozoa is a large and diverse group, but certain features are common to many of its members. The amoebozoan cell is typically divided into a granular central mass, called endoplasm, and a clear outer layer, called ectoplasm.

Polychaos dubium was previously known as Amoeba dubia. [2] The author who named the species later recognized it as different from species of Amoeba, and so designated it the type species of the genus Polychaos. [1] Unlike species of Amoeba, P. dubium lacks longitudinal ridges on its pseudopods. [5]
Amoebozoa of the free living genus Acanthamoeba and the social amoeba genus Dictyostelium are single celled eukaryotic organisms that feed on bacteria, fungi, and algae through phagocytosis, with digestion occurring in phagolysosomes. Amoebozoa are present in most terrestrial ecosystems including soil and freshwater. [1]
